FAQ

What formatting can a cell style include?

  1. A cell style can combine multiple formatting settings.
  2. Common items include number format, font, border, and fill.
  3. After you choose a style, those settings are applied to the selected cells according to the style definition.

How do I modify an existing style?

  1. Open the Cell Styles gallery.
  2. Find the style you want to adjust.
  3. Right-click the style, choose Modify, and then update the related settings.

What happens to cells that already use a style after I modify it?

  1. After you modify and save the style, cells that already use that style update together.
  2. The updated content usually includes the font, border, fill, and other formatting defined in that style.
  3. If you want to keep the original appearance, create a separate style first and apply them separately.

Glossary

TermDefinition
Cell StyleA preset or custom formatting scheme that combines multiple cell formatting settings.
Style GalleryThe list area that stores preset and custom styles for quick selection.
Number FormatA setting that controls how numbers are displayed, such as percentage, currency, or decimal places.
